The Biggest Celebrity Hair Transformations of 2020

2020 is a year that will go down in hair transformation history.

Among the many strategies used to cope with lockdown and feeling a loss of control, major hair switch-ups emerged as one way for individuals to mark a significant change in their life-or just say “fuck it” and express themselves without apology. While celebrities are no stranger to transformation, there was a shift toward more directional statement haircuts and colorful hues (hence the newly coined term “self-dye-solation”) that offered both inspiration and an air of optimism in difficult times.

“A woman who cuts her hair is about to change her life,” Coco Chanel once said. In that spirit, Demi Lovato “did a thing” by lopping off her chest-grazing lengths into an undercut dyed platinum blonde, while Halsey and Tallulah Willis took starting anew to the extreme with fresh buzz cuts. Others took the plunge with directional layers. As the mullet grew in popularity during the pandemic, Rihanna and Troye Sivan took on the notorious so-bad-it’s-good style with confident aplomb. Rosalía and Gigi Hadid went a more subtle route by adopting curtains of soft fringe. Quarantine also proved to be an opportune time to embrace born-with-it texture. At the beginning of lockdown, Gabrielle Union showed off her natural curls, while over the summer, Megan Thee Stallion unveiled her halo of of tight coils.

On the hair color front, the year saw a wide spectrum of tints, shades, and tones. On one end, there was Kaia Gerber and Emily Ratajkowski, who temporarily traded their natural brunette for golden platinum blonde. And on the other, full-on fantasy color with Lizzo and Kim Kardashian West both rocking fire engine red lengths, Ciara and Lady Gaga opting for icy shades of blue, and Georgia May Jagger debuting a bold, two-tone blue and purple dye job inspired by Harley Quinn in Birds of Prey. Here, a look back at 2020’s biggest year-defining hair transformation moments.
